The world this week, deposit return scheme, energy, social media, St Dwynwen

Sunday Supplement

Available for 28 days

IMI Media's chief international anchor Hadley Gamble discusses the week that was. Owen Derbyshire from Keep Wales Tidy explains why he's written to the UK government asking for Wales to be exempted from a UK-wide bottle deposit scheme. Energy Minister Michael Shanks talks about energy efficiency. Tonia Antoniazzi MP advocates for a social media ban for under 16s. Archdruid and chair of Welsh and Celtic Studies at Aberystwyth University Mererid Hopwood tells us all about St Dwynwen and other popular Welsh traditions at this time of year. Leader of the Vale's conservatives, Cllr George Carroll and employment lawyer Bethan Darwin review the papers.
